How to Copy an Audiobook CD to an iPod

Copy an Audiobook CD to an iPod

An audiobook CD is an audio recording of a book on a compact disc. An iPod is a portable media player manufactured by Apple Inc. You can copy an audiobook CD to your iPod by importing the CD into your computer's iTunes program, and then syncing iTunes with your iPod. This will allow you to listen to the audiobook on your iPod.

Things You'll Need

  • Computer with iTunes
  • iPod data cable

Instructions

    • 1

      Open the iTunes program on your computer.

    • 2

      Insert the audiobook CD into your computer's CD drive, and wait for the list of audiobook tracks to display in iTunes.

    • 3

      Select all of the audiobook tracks by clicking "Edit" from the iTunes toolbar menu, and choosing the "Select All" option.

    • 4

      Click the "Advanced" tab in the toolbar menu, and select the "Join CD Tracks" option. This will convert the individual tracks into a single track.

    • 5

      Click the "Advanced" tab and select the "Submit CD Track Names" option. A dialog box will open. Enter pertinent information about the audiobook, such as the title and author. Click "OK."

    • 6

      Click the "Import" button at the top right corner of the iTunes window. Note that the import process may take several minutes to complete.

    • 7

      Attach the iPod data cable to the bottom of your iPod, and connect the other end to any available USB port on your computer.

    • 8

      Select your iPod from the list of devices on the left side of the iTunes window.

    • 9

      Click the "Music" tab.

    • 10

      Select the audiobook by placing a checkmark in the box to the left of the audiobook's name or author.

    • 11

      Click the "Sync" button to copy the audiobook from iTunes to your iPod.

Tips & Warnings

  • If your audiobook has multiple discs, include the disc number in each title, so that you can easily sequence the discs in the correct order.

  • To make your audiobook file bookmarkable, right-click on the track in iTunes. Select "Get Info," and click on the "Options" tab. Put a checkmark in the box next to "Remember playback position." This will enable your iPod to return automatically to the place where you stopped listening.

  • You can also use the "Options" tab to prevent the iPod from including the audiobook in random shuffling, by clicking "Skip while shuffling."
